The 2023-2024 NBA season was rumored to be a year of potential reunions for the Philadelphia 76ers.

As the Sixers search for deals on deadline day, they’ve been frequently linked to the veteran guard Alec Burks. The Detroit Pistons sharpshooter was once again a popular trade candidate amongst contending teams, and several reports noted that Philadelphia had an interest.

You could say the 32-year-old guard has unfinished business in Philly. Back in 2020, the Sixers made a deadline-day trade for the veteran while he was in the midst of a career year with the Golden State Warriors.

In 48 games, Burks averaged 16 points and three assists while he knocked down 38 percent of his threes. After getting off to a hot start, the Warriors flipped him to the Sixers. Philly hoped Burks would be a notable boost off the bench as they looked to make a deep run in the 2020 playoffs. Unfortunately, they were stopped way short by the Boston Celtics, who swept them in the first round.

Burks’ time in Philadelphia would last 18 regular-season games. During that stretch, he averaged 12 points and two assists while hitting 42 percent of his threes. In the playoffs, Burks averaged 11 points and struggled mightily with his shot, knocking down just 33 percent of his field goal attempts.

Once Burks hit the free agency market, he eyed a new destination and inked a deal with the New York Knicks. His original contract was a one-season deal, which turned into a brand new three-year contract the following summer. Burks would play for the Knicks from 2020 to 2022 before finding himself moved to Detroit two offseason ago.

Once again, the veteran guard was a popular candidate. Playing on a struggling Pistons team, Burks’ numbers are attractive for a win-now roster. In 43 games, he’s averaged 13 points and two assists while knocking down 40 percent of his threes in 21 minutes of action per game.

He won’t be headed back to the City of Brotherly Love, but Burks will get a reunion this season.

According to ESPN’s Adrian Wojnarowski, the Pistons are sending Alec Burks to the Knicks. In exchange, the Pistons are expected to land Quentin Grimes and multiple second-round picks.

Burks boosts the bench backcourt for one of the hottest teams in the league. During his previous run in New York, Burks averaged 12 points, five rebounds, and three assists. He hit 41 percent of his threes across two seasons.
